﻿id	summary	reporter	owner	description	type	status	priority	milestone	component	version	resolution	keywords	cc
12570	Group similar tests	naoliv	team	"I am seeing a lot of similar tests giving ungrouped results.
For example:

[[Image(http://i.imgur.com/xjGxous.png)]]

What I could quickly see that are needing some grouping are:

In errors:
* wrong collection_times
* wrong opening_hours

In warnings:
* 'email': E-mail address contains an invalid username
* 'contact:email': E-mail address contains an invalid username
* website: URL contains an invalid authority | URL contains an invalid path
* lot of opening_hours tests
* service_times tests
* shop=something inside shop=something
* leisure=something inside leisure=something
* tourism=something inside tourism=something
* amenity=something inside amenity=something


Basically everything that is using key and/or name in the warning message should be grouped, if possible (like it happened for the ""Long segments"" test)

JOSM:
{{{
URL:http://josm.openstreetmap.de/svn/trunk
Repository:UUID: 0c6e7542-c601-0410-84e7-c038aed88b3b
Last:Changed Date: 2016-02-25 01:51:43 +0100 (Thu, 25 Feb 2016)
Build-Date:2016-02-26 02:34:44
Revision:9881
Relative:URL: ^/trunk

Identification: JOSM/1.5 (9881 en) Linux Debian GNU/Linux testing (stretch)
Memory Usage: 4065 MB / 9102 MB (1021 MB allocated, but free)
Java version: 1.8.0_72-internal-b05, Oracle Corporation, OpenJDK 64-Bit Server VM
VM arguments: [-Dawt.useSystemAAFontSettings=on]
Dataset consistency test: No problems found
}}}"	enhancement	closed	normal	16.07	Core validator		fixed	grouping	Don-vip
